What Is A Landscape Architect?
Landscape designers are professionals who work to create outdoor spaces that offer both functionality and wonderful aesthetics. They work with clients to design outdoor spaces that meet their requirements within a specific budget. The types of properties that landscape designers might work on include:
Residential Properties - Homeowners looking to maximise and enhance their garden spaces may use a landscape architect or designer to help them plan and design an improved garden space.
Commercial Properties - Commercial spaces such as offices, businesses, and other organisations with outdoor areas may enlist the help of landscape designers. They may be after a certain aesthetic to match their brand image and give a professional look.
Educational Institutions - Educational institutions such as schools, colleges, and universities may need landscaping to help them make their spaces aesthetically pleasing, while still being functional and practical for pupils, visitors, or staff. Aesthetically pleasing educational spaces can also be more enticing for parents and pupils who are considering attending.
Hospitality Venues - Hospitality venues such as hotels, estates, manor houses, and other venues with outdoor space may require the help of landscape professionals to help them curate their outdoor space, making it look aesthetically pleasing.
The Role of Landscape Architects in Shaping Outdoor Venues
Landscaping professionals can enhance a property or venue massively in a range of ways. Read below to understand how landscape architects help with shaping outdoor venues.
Creating A Unique Venue
One of the key roles a landscape architect plays in outdoor venue enhancement is creating a wonderful and unique venue identity. The use of plants, pathways, and even water features can reflect a venue's natural charm or help it achieve a more modern or rustic look. Through the careful selection of materials, plants, and the layout of the outdoor space, architects can create visually pleasing and memorable event settings.
Optimising Space
Landscape architects will design spaces that optimise the flow of people for an event, depending on different activities. They will ensure easy access to various event areas, as well as larger spaces for mingling. They consider how to best use the outdoor space in a way that makes a property adaptable to different events.
Natural Elements
Landscape professionals will be experienced in utilising natural features and existing natural elements on your property. Bodies of water, plants, and trees can be used by your landscape architect, combined with new flowers and plants to enhance the venue's aesthetic. Architects will typically use low-maintenance plants and flowers for these spaces so that there is minimal upkeep and year-round appeal for venue owners or event planners.
Adding Value with Bespoke Features
Adding value through bespoke features is another way that landscape architects can help make your venue special. From pergolas, gazebos, and even water features, landscape professionals can incorporate bespoke elements to enhance your hospitality venue for event organisers and guests attending.
Long-Term Planning & Maintenance
Landscape architects will choose materials and structures with long-term planning in mind. The materials and structures they decide to use on your property will be carefully considered and built to last. This helps to reduce the amount of maintenance needed for certain elements of your outdoor space. They may also provide you with maintenance plans or guidance, ensuring that your venue stays in proper condition and the aesthetics of your space are maintained.
Safety Considerations for Outdoor Venues
While landscaping professionals take aesthetics and practicality into great consideration, another key area that they focus on is safety. When designing and working with outdoor spaces, especially event spaces, safety is a crucial consideration that needs to be made.
Tree & Vegetation Health - Tree assessments and other evaluations are crucial for outdoor spaces to ensure the site is safe from falling branches, toppling trees, and other hazards.
Pathways - Pathways need to be slip-free, especially in high-traffic areas during events. Textured stones and good drainage can help pathways become less slippery and much safer for guests.
Accessibility - For event spaces, ramps and pathways need to be accessible for everyone, considering those with mobility issues.
Drainage - Good drainage is crucial for outdoor event spaces as it prevents water from collecting and creating slippery surfaces, which can cause falls or accidental slips.
Weather-Proofing - Adding pergolas, trees, and shaded areas for sun protection can be a great addition, especially during the summer. These structures and décor elements should also be fitted with extremely secure foundations to withstand windy conditions.
Outdoor Venue Spaces: The Benefits
Outdoor events are often a popular choice, especially during the summer months. A well-maintained and properly landscaped outdoor venue can offer natural beauty and many other benefits. Read below to learn more about why outdoor events can be beneficial with the right venue.
Natural Scenery
A well-designed outdoor venue can make the most of natural scenery, allowing the landscape and plants to act as décor. This can be great for event spaces and various properties. For hospitality venues, natural landscaping adds both visual appeal and gives more flexibility to guests. By emphasising the venue's natural elements, such as greenery, plants, and open space, venue operators can take a 'less is more' approach, allowing the space to be the decoration.
Space for Guests
Outdoor venues are a valuable part of hosting events for hospitality venues. Outdoor spaces are great during summer and autumn, especially for larger groups, giving them the space to move around freely and socialise. Spacious outdoor settings allow guests the freedom to explore in an inviting environment. For large corporate events or social gatherings, large outdoor spaces provide more flexibility and freedom to accommodate larger groups.
Memorable Experiences
Outdoor events have the advantage of being more memorable, especially with the right landscaping. There are endless ways that hospitality venues can utilise natural scenery to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their property, making it a memorable and special event for guests.
